How much do government remote technical writer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for government remote technical writer in Reston, VA is $40.51,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$30.00 and $49.04 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Government Remote Technical Writer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Government Remote Technical Writer, you need exceptional writing, editing, and research skills, often supported by a degree in English, communications, or a related field. Familiarity with document management systems, federal style guides (such as the Plain Language Guidelines), and software like Microsoft Office or Adobe Acrobat is typically required. Strong attention to detail, self-motivation, and the ability to communicate complex information clearly are key soft skills. These skills ensure that government documents are accurate, compliant, and easily understood by diverse stakeholders, even when working remotely.

How does a Government Remote Technical Writer typically collaborate with subject matter experts (SMEs) and project teams while working offsite?

As a Government Remote Technical Writer, you will frequently collaborate with SMEs and project teams through virtual meetings, email, and project management platforms. Regular communication is essential to clarify complex technical information and ensure accuracy in documentation. Building strong remote working relationships and proactively seeking feedback are key to overcoming the challenge of limited in-person interaction. Most agencies use secure collaboration tools and document-sharing platforms to facilitate seamless teamwork and maintain compliance with government information security standards.

What are Government Remote Technical Writers?

Government Remote Technical Writers are professionals who create, edit, and organize technical documentation for government agencies or contractors while working from a remote location. Their work includes preparing manuals, reports, policies, and guides that clarify complex information for specific audiences such as the public, agency staff, or stakeholders. They collaborate with subject matter experts, ensure compliance with government standards, and use specialized software tools to produce clear and accurate documents. Remote technical writers must have strong writing, research, and communication skills, and often require knowledge of government regulations and technical subjects.

Swingtech Consulting, Inc. is seeking a Technical Writer to support documentation, reporting, user guidance, process documentation, and deliverable development for federal training and learning management programs.
This role supports the creation and maintenance of clear, accurate, accessible, and well-organized documentation for web-based training platforms, learning management systems, digital learning products, help desk operations, reporting processes, and program support activities. The ideal candidate should be detail-oriented, organized, and able to work with technical, training, QA, data, and program teams to turn inputs into customer-ready documentation.
Key Responsibilities
  • Research content to develop, edit, format, and maintain technical documentation, process documentation, user guides, job aids, reports, meeting materials, and program deliverables
  • Translate information from technical teams, instructional designers, data analysts, QA staff, help desk personnel, and program leadership into clear documentation
  • Support documentation for web-based applications, learning management systems, training workflows, user support procedures, reporting processes, and operational activities
  • Prepare and maintain standard operating procedures, knowledge base articles, FAQs, release notes, user instructions, and internal support materials
  • Review documentation for clarity, consistency, grammar, formatting, accuracy, and alignment with customer requirements
  • Support recurring deliverables such as monthly reports, meeting minutes, action item logs, status updates, and documentation packages
  • Maintain organized documentation repositories, templates, revision histories, source files, and final deliverable versions
  • Track edits, stakeholder comments, revisions, approvals, and document status through completion
  • Support accessible document formatting and apply Section 508 or similar accessibility considerations to electronic deliverables
  • Coordinate with cross-functional teams to collect inputs, validate content, resolve comments, and prepare submission-ready documents
  • Assist with documenting system updates, training product revisions, issue resolution steps, and operational procedures
  • Contribute to improvements in templates, naming conventions, document workflows, and knowledge management practices

Minimum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Technical Writing, English, Communications, Information Technology, Education, Business, or a related field; equivalent experience may be considered
  • At least 3 years of experience in technical writing, documentation development, content editing, reporting, or related documentation work
  • Experience developing technical, operational, training, user support, or process documentation
  • Strong writing, editing, formatting, proofreading, and document organization skills
  • Ability to gather inputs from multiple stakeholders and produce clear, accurate, and usable documentation
  • Familiarity with document control, templates, style guides, version management, and review cycles
  • Working knowledge of accessibility considerations for electronic documents, including Section 508 or comparable standards
  • Strong attention to detail and ability to manage multiple documentation tasks and deadlines
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ills
  • Ability to work independently and collaboratively in a remote environment
